This study aimed to (1) find out the feasibility of the SRLBS bilingual module, and (2) find out the difference between the final results of the bilingual SRLBS module learning with conventional learning. The research method consists of (1) research and information collection; (2) planning; (3) develop preliminary form of product; (4) preliminary field testing; (5) main product revision; (6) main field testing; (7) operational product revision; (8) operational field testing; (9) final product revision; and (10) dissemination and implementation. This study used data analysis techniques Djemari Mardapi for feasibility of product and t test for the determination of the hypothesis (paired sample t test & paired sample correlation). The results obtained in the form of (1) bilingual SRLBS module products have been categorized as feasible according to expert judgment, and (2) the module (SRLBS) has the potential to impact students in the form of improved metacognitive abilities, cognitive abilites, and foreign languages.
